A reconstructed samurai residence turned open-air museum.
Built based on historical drawings after the original was lost in the Boshin War, Aizu Bukeyashiki offers a glimpse into what life in a high-ranking samurai household may have looked like. It’s not an original structure, but the scale of the buildings, gardens, and interiors still makes it an interesting stop if you want to learn more about Aizu beyond the castle.

*During my visit, I was given an English route map for the museum, but it didn’t match the Japanese one, which was the correct version. If they haven’t updated it yet, I’d recommend asking for a Japanese map as well, just in case.
